    The AF-406 looks like a nice small-format folder, but it is not a pharmaceutical folder. These are two totally different machines.

    To the OP: You should contact the companies in this thread, along with finished samples of what you wish to perform on the folder. In this arena, experience is key. Setups take days instead of minutes due to the sheer number of variables - be it the material being folded, the environment, or the fold to be performed.
